Détails du cours

Understanding Age-Related Macular Degeneration (AMD): Definition, causes, risk factors, and prevalence
Anatomy and Function of the Macula: Importance in vision, layers, and cells of the macula
Types of AMD: Early, intermediate, and late-stage AMD; dry and wet AMD
Diagnosis of AMD: Clinical exams, imaging techniques, and genetic testing
Symptoms and Visual Effects of AMD: Distorted vision, central vision loss, and legal blindness
Treatment Options for AMD: Anti-VEGF therapy, laser therapy, photodynamic therapy, and nutritional interventions
Lifestyle Changes to Manage AMD: Smoking cessation, exercise, healthy diet, UV protection, and blue light filters
Low Vision Aids and Rehabilitation: Assistive devices, vision rehabilitation, and support services
Emerging Research and Therapies for AMD: Stem cell therapy, gene therapy, and drug delivery systems
